
The Wensleydale Creamery in Hawes is offering free entry for children to its Cheese Experience.
Between Saturday, August 19 and Sunday, September 3, children under 16 will get free entry to the centre.
A spokesperson for the creamery said: “They’ll be able to enjoy a host of interactive activities.
“From tasting their delicious range of handcrafted cheese, to watching live demonstrations, taking the new cheese trail quiz, getting a peek inside the creamery, and even have their picture taken with Yorkshire Wensleydale’s most famous fans – Wallace & Gromit, it’s the perfect place to entertain the children this summer.”
